Call for Southeast Asian Artists to Join Solarpunk Exhibition and Residency
About This Opportunity
Artists from Cambodia and across the region are being invited to apply to take part in a digital art exhibition and residency to help shape a sustainable future through art that challenges climate doom while empowering communities. An open call is being made for artists, designers, futurists and environmentalists to apply for a place on a new project that celebrates the “solarpunk” movement, but given a Southeast Asian twist. “Solarpunk is a growing art and literary movement that stands as a stark contrast to dystopian visions like cyberpunk. It imagines, and actively works towards, a better world where nature and community thrive, powered by renewable energy and rooted in community-based practices,” a press release said. “The "solar" represents optimism and a focus on clean energy, while the "punk" embodies a countercultural, DIY ethos. This project aims to cultivate a distinctly Southeast Asian version of this movement, integrating local culture, traditional knowledge and resilient ways of life.”
